If an enemy grabs Lara, quickly alternate between pressing the Left and Right Arrow keys to make her break free from his grasp. Some enemies may grab Lara and shake her about. With practice, using adrenaline can significantly increase Lara’s chances in combat. Timing is critical! If Lara dodges too late, her enemy may still hit her. If Lara shoots before the two reticles overlap, she will not perform a headshot.Īdrenaline dodges are special evasive moves that can only be used in response to rage attacks. To successfully execute a headshot, wait until the two targeting reticles align over the enemy and turn red, then left-click to shoot. If done correctly, time will be slowed and Lara will have the opportunity to return fire and attempt a headshot on her enemy. To dodge the attack, run left, right or backwards, and while running press the Shift (⇧) key. When this happens, the screen will blur to indicate that Lara can now perform an adrenaline dodge. If an enemy performs a rage attack, Lara’s adrenaline will kick in to respond to the impending threat. When this happens, they will charge at Lara and perform a “rage attack”. Parents should watch for or ask their children about the above symptoms-children and teenagers are more likely than adults to experience these seizures. Immediately stop playing and consult a doctor if you experience any of these symptoms. Seizures may also cause loss of consciousness or convulsions that can lead to injury from falling down or striking nearby objects. These seizures may have a variety of symptoms, including lightheadedness, altered vision, eye or face twitching, jerking or shaking of arms or legs, disorientation, confusion, or momentary loss of awareness. Even people who have no history of seizures or epilepsy may have an undiagnosed condition that can cause these “photosensitive epileptic seizures” while watching video games. The 2013 Traverse received a new grille and front fascia, a redesigned rear liftgate, and reworked Camaro-inspired tail lights, and the transmission was reworked for improved shift quality and timing. The Traverse has unique sheet metal different from the other Lambda crossovers, with the exception of the doors.Ī facelift of the Chevrolet Traverse was unveiled at the 2012 New York International Auto Show. The production Traverse's design was inspired by the 2005 Chevrolet Sequel concept, and has a chevron-shaped grille similar to the 2008 Chevrolet Malibu. The first Traverse was built at GM's Spring Hill, Tennessee, assembly plant during 2009, until its production was moved to GM's Delta Township, Michigan assembly plant in 2010. The 2009 Chevrolet Traverse debuted at the 2008 Chicago Auto Show and the Traverse had arrived at every Chevrolet dealer in October 2008. GM Lambda platform/GMT561 (Series GMT960) United States: Spring Hill, Tennessee (2009) Lansing Delta Township Assembly, Lansing, Michigan (2010–2017) The Traverse name was originally used for a concept car at the 2003 North American International Auto Show in Detroit, but that concept gave way when the Equinox launched for the 2005 model year.
